
Diesel fuel contains paraffin wax, which helps engines generate more power and efficiency. However, in freezing temperatures, the wax crystallizes, thickens the fuel, and eventually clogs the fuel filter and lines, causing the engine to shut down. This process is known as diesel fuel gelling, and it typically occurs when temperatures drop below 32 degrees Fahrenheit. To prevent this, you can use additives or anti-gel supplements, store your vehicle in a heated environment, or mix kerosene with your diesel fuel to lower its freezing point.

Use anti-gel fuel additives to prevent fuel line freeze-ups
Diesel fuel contains paraffin wax, which improves its viscosity and lubrication. However, in freezing temperatures, the wax solidifies and turns into a cloudy mixture, eventually leading to diesel fuel gelling. This can cause fuel line freeze-ups and clog your engine's fuel filters and lines, stopping fuel from flowing and rendering your engine useless.
To prevent this, you can use anti-gel fuel additives, which are easy to use – you just top off your fuel tank with the treatment. Anti-gel additives drop the freezing point of diesel fuel so that it is less likely to freeze in cold temperatures. They are designed to lower the Cold Filter Plugging Point (CFPP), which is the lowest temperature at which fuel will still flow through a specific filter.

Switch to No. 1 fuel diesel, which doesn't contain paraffin wax
Diesel fuel contains paraffin wax, which improves its viscosity and lubrication. However, in freezing temperatures, the wax begins to solidify, turning into a cloudy mixture. This eventually leads to diesel fuel gelling, which can clog fuel filters and lines, stopping fuel flow and rendering your engine useless.
No. 2 diesel fuel, which is typically used in vehicles, contains paraffin wax. When temperatures drop below 32 degrees Fahrenheit, the wax starts to crystalize, and at around 14-15 degrees Fahrenheit, it completely crystallizes, causing fuel filters to clog.
To prevent diesel fuel from gelling, you can switch to No. 1 diesel fuel, which does not contain paraffin wax and can withstand temperatures as low as -40 degrees Fahrenheit (-40 degrees Celsius). This is a significant advantage in colder regions, where No. 1 diesel may be more readily available. However, it's important to note that No. 1 diesel may not be available in warmer regions, and it may also have some disadvantages, such as reduced fuel mileage and efficiency.
If you choose to switch to No. 1 diesel, it's important to ensure that your engine is compatible with this type of fuel. Additionally, you may need to take into account the availability and cost of No. 1 diesel in your area.
Overall, switching to No. 1 diesel fuel that doesn't contain paraffin wax is an effective way to prevent diesel fuel from gelling in freezing temperatures, but it's important to consider the limitations and suitability for your specific situation.

Store your vehicle in a heated garage or use a block heater
If you live in a region where temperatures consistently drop below freezing, storing your vehicle in a heated garage is an effective way to prevent diesel fuel gelling. By maintaining a warm environment, you eliminate the risk of freezing temperatures affecting your vehicle's fuel system.
A heated garage, particularly one with climate control, ensures that your vehicle's fuel remains in a liquid state and flows freely through the fuel filters. This method is ideal because it addresses the root cause of the problem by removing the exposure to cold temperatures.
However, it is understandable that not everyone has access to a heated garage. In such cases, an alternative solution is to use a block heater, which is a modern device designed to protect your vehicle from frigid temperatures. A block heater is installed directly on the engine, providing targeted heat to keep the fuel from freezing. While this option may result in higher electricity costs, it is an effective way to safeguard your vehicle's fuel system during cold weather.
Additionally, there are other creative ways to apply heat and protect your vehicle. One method involves placing a series of light bulbs under the vehicle, emitting heat upwards. Another approach is to wrap the vehicle in a tarp and direct a heater towards it, creating a localized warm environment. These innovative solutions demonstrate the importance of heat in preventing diesel fuel issues during freezing temperatures.

Mix diesel with kerosene, which has a lower freezing point
Kerosene has a lower freezing point than diesel, typically freezing at around −40°C/-40°F. This makes it a good option to mix with diesel fuel to lower the freezing temperature of the mixture.
Mixing diesel with kerosene is a common solution to prevent diesel fuel from gelling at low temperatures. This method involves modifying the fuel mixture itself, which can be done by mixing kerosene with diesel fuel. The amount of kerosene added will determine the extent of the freezing point reduction. For example, adding 10% kerosene will lower the cold filter plugging point of a diesel fuel blend by five degrees. In extremely cold weather, it may be more cost-effective to use kerosene as a mixer than a cold flow polymer.
However, there are some disadvantages to using kerosene. Firstly, it is considered a polluting fuel by the World Health Organization (WHO) due to its smoke containing particulate matter that can be harmful to health. Additionally, kerosene has reduced fuel mileage and efficiency, and it may not be readily available in all regions. It is also a harsher fuel that lacks lubrication, which can damage diesel injector pumps unless a lubricant is added.
While kerosene can be effective in preventing diesel fuel from freezing, it is generally recommended to use additives, lubricants, and winter-safe diesel engine oil to maintain engine health and performance.
